温度变化对高寒草地牧鸡行为影响初探

摘    要:于2009年6、7月在高寒草地观察不同温度条件下放牧青脚麻鸡的行为习性表达。结果表明,当地面温度(距地面1 cm)在3~8 ℃时,牧鸡开始活动;采食行为一般发生在10~37 ℃;而温度介于15~38 ℃时,牧鸡求偶;静卧行为通常发生在较高(38~42 ℃)和较低(低于5 ℃)的温度条件下。最高采食频率发生在15~27 ℃。观察发现,早晚牧鸡的活动行为表达没有显著差异(P>0.05)。游憩和采食受瞬时温度影响较其他行为明显。静息、求偶和游憩行为表达在不同性别间差异显著(P<0.05),公鸡静息、求偶和游憩行为显著高于母鸡,但母鸡采食行为明显多于公鸡。

The effects of temperature on the behaviors of free-ranging chicken in the alpine grassland

Abstract:An experiment was conducted to observe the effects of different temperature on the behaviors of free-ranging chicken in the alpine grassland during June-July,2009.This study showed that chicken began to walk when the temperatures(shaded air temperature 1 cm above soil surface) was 3-8 ℃,and started foraging behavior while temperatures was 10-37 ℃,and began to courtship once temperatures reached 15-38 ℃.Quiescence was often observed at the lowest temperature with the below 5 ℃ and highest site temperature with the over 38-42 ℃,and the highest frequency of foraging was often observed when temperature was of 15-27 ℃.There’s no significant difference between frequency of activities in morning and evening(P>0.05).Males rested,courted,and groomed significantly more frequently than females did,and females foraged significantly more than that of males(P<0.05).Activity patterns,especially quiescence and foraging,were influenced much more by environmental temperature than by time of day.
